The quote for sacrifice cult, while I'm sure it exists, is wrong. The actual religion of satanism does not perform sacrifice. It admits there is energy in the life force which could be acquired through sacrifice of an animal or person, but considers it feeble when compared to the life force exercised by the practitioner giving himself over to an emotion which resonates with the purpose of a performed ritual, whether anger for destruction, lust for sex, or charity/sorrow for a compassion ritual.
Certainly there are likely individuals who worship the christian entity satan who kill things in a deluded belief that they are sacrificing to perform magic in an attempt to live with them self after killing a being in cold blood. Adherents of the actual religion called satanism, however, believe that animals and children are sacred due their innocence and purity, never harm children, and would only harm animals in self defense or for food. The quote is similar to stories of the fiction of Satanic Ritual Abuse, damaging to a religion of, ultimately, misguided individuals who've grown a thick shell to repel an all to often painful life.
